Question 1 of 5
The most common cause of perinatal mortality in preterm infants is:
Correct Answer: A
Rationale: Respiratory distress syndrome (RDS) is the most common cause of perinatal mortality in preterm infants, caused by insufficient surfactant production leading to lung collapse and difficulty breathing.

Question 4 of 5
Pervasive developmental disorders, also known as autism spectrum disorders (ASDs), consist of five disorders. The hallmark of these disorders is
Correct Answer: B
Rationale: Impaired communication and social interaction are core features of ASDs, distinguishing them from other developmental disorders.
